2007 Evinrude E TEC - Starcraft Marine LEWT kicks off the season with full field

The Western Basin Sportfishing Association (WBSA) will kick off the 2007 Lake Erie Walleye Trail (LEWT) along with title sponsors Starcraft Marine and Evinrude E TEC on Sunday April 1st. This first event will set the tone for what will surely be an exciting year for the anglers of the LEWT.

The teams will take off from Fenwick Marina at 8 AM and have to be back by 4 PM for the weigh in. The public is invited to join the participants for the weigh in as this can be a great opportunity to ask questions and learn some of the fine points of walleye fishing from the tournament anglers. There will also be a drawing at the weigh in to award the Gander Mountain Early Bird Award to one of the teams that signed up for all four regular events during the early registration period.

“We are pleased to announce that once again this year we will have West Marine supplying donuts and coffee in the morning for the teams and refreshments in the afternoon at the weigh in” remarked Marc Hudson, WBSA President.

The first event in 2006 gave us our closest finish ever with just one tenth of a pound separating the top two teams and also our big fish of the year of 12 pounds even. With a little cooperation from the weather this year the kick off event should provide more exciting action. Tournament Director Matt Davis commented “We are pleased to have the first event of the year fill up almost 2 weeks before the tournament and we have a real good number of entries for the May tournament already. It looks like this year will be an excellent year of growth for the LEWT.”

The WBSA is a Social based Club for fishermen and women that fish in the Western Basin of Lake Erie and its tributaries. Membership is open to all fisher people no matter what their location. Our goal is to present information in a manner that will help sustain and improve fishing in one of the greatest inland sport fisheries in the world. Scientific information, fishing techniques, locations and presentations will be presented at our monthly meetings by expert and knowledgeable speakers and tournament anglers in our group. These anglers are very open with techniques and methods and will help any member that is trying to learn new methods
